2008 HYUNDAI VERACRUZ RECALLS
5 doors suv produced by Hyundai from 2006 to 2011 with diesel and petrol engines. Capacity is 5 passengers including driver.

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ING:ENGINE
-
Total cars affected: 61122
-
NHTSA campaign: 14V415000
-
Date of the problem: 08/07/2014
If the alternator is damaged, the charging system warning lamp in the instrument cluster will illuminate, and the engine will lose power and the vehicle will eventually stop operating while being driven. An unexpected failure of motive power while driving increases the risk of a crash.

EXTERIOR LIGHTING:BRAKE LIGHTS:SWITCH
-
Total cars affected: 1712336
-
NHTSA campaign: 13V113000
-
Date of the problem: 01/04/2013
Failure to illuminate the stop lamps during braking or inability to disengage the cruise control could increase the risk of a crash. Additionally, when the ignition is in the 'ON' position, the transmission shifter may be able to be moved out of Park without first applying the brake. This may lead to unintentional movement of the car which may increase the risk of a crash.
AIR BAGS:FRONTAL
-
Total cars affected: 205233
-
NHTSA campaign: 11V472000
-
Date of the problem: 09/09/2011
IF THE CLOCK SPRING DEVELOPS HIGH RESISTANCE, IN THE EVENT OF A CRASH, THE DRIVERS AIR BAG WILL NOT DEPLOY AND WILL NOT BE ABLE TO PROPERLY PROTECT THE DRIVER, INCREASING THE RISK OF INJURIES.
